Job Summary This position is a Lead Application Programmer Analyst position for the ISD ERP HR & Payroll team and is responsible for providing IT application programming support for the Infor Lawson ERP system. The candidate must have knowledge of COBOL. Previous experience with the Infor Lawson ERP system, or SQL, or UNIX, or .NET would be a plus. Testing and coordinating of IT activities will be required. On-call required. Good communication skills both verbally and written required.

Principal Accountabilities Performs advanced design, coding, debugging, testing and implementation tasks for the more complex computer programs and systems, leading other programmers when required.

Leads the processing and completion of service requests/projects according to established schedules and timeframes.

Maintains an effective level of coordination on assigned projects.

Translates user and department information needs into technical solutions.

Addresses and resolves user issues and develops an understanding of user terminology.

Provides customer support to both internal and external customers.

Acts as an advocate for enforcing technical, programming and application standards.

Serves as a primary team contributor and sets team participation example for others.

Develops an understanding of ISD solution segments.

Develops and implements program documentation.

Conducts meetings.
